2014 TND to SAR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2014

During 2014, the TND to SAR ex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 12, valuing the pair at 2.3909.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 23, dropping to 2.0089.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.3820 SAR.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 2.2821 to the December average rate of 2.0214, the exchange rate registered a net change of -11.42%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2014 high of 2.3909 was down 2.02% compared to the 2013 peak of 2.4402,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 2.3367 2.2603 2.2821
February 2.3779 2.3344 2.3581
March 2.3909 2.3662 2.3781
April 2.3738 2.3400 2.3604
May 2.3431 2.2962 2.3156
June 2.2994 2.2257 2.2597
July 2.2292 2.1723 2.1926
August 2.1911 2.1525 2.1758
September 2.1536 2.0827 2.1172
October 2.0932 2.0618 2.0811
November 2.0612 2.0371 2.0467
December 2.0399 2.0089 2.0214
